Nestled in a bustling area of northeast London, Stamford Hill Train Station might not boast the grandeur of some of the larger transport hubs, but it offers essential services to its daily commuters and visitors. Conveniently located within the London Borough of Hackney, this station serves as a gateway to several interesting destinations and provides connectivity for those living in the surrounding areas.
Stamford Hill station doesn't have a ticket office, but there are ticket machines available for your convenience. These machines can be used to purchase and collect tickets, including those bought online, ensuring your journey starts smoothly. They are accessible to all customers, including those with disabilities. The station also supports basic customer assistance via an information point and has staff on hand for help during most hours of the week. CCTV is operational for security, although there is no lost property office outside the standard workweek hours.
For those seeking a digital edge, the station provides public Wi-Fi. There are no refreshment or shopping facilities onsite, so it might be wise to grab that coffee and snack before arriving. Though the station lacks certain facilities, like a waiting room or accessible toilets, it ensures a basic level of comfort with seating areas and helpful signage to assist travelers with disabilities.

Stamford Hill Station has made strides in accessibility, ensuring accessible ticket machines and an induction loop for those who are hearing impaired. Assistance staff are available daily, catering to the needs of passengers with various mobility constraints. However, it lacks step-free access and doesn’t offer wheelchairs or ramps, so it’s good to plan ahead if you require additional assistance.

Nestled in the picturesque landscape of Suffolk, Thurston Train Station serves as a charming hub for travelers exploring both local attractions and further destinations. While it may not boast an array of conveniences found in larger stations, it makes up for it with its quaint charm and essential amenities.
Thurston Train Station is equipped with a ticket machine that allows you to collect tickets purchased online, and it features a smartcard validator, though sadly no smartcards are issued at the station. Accessibility is a key consideration, with step-free access available on both platforms, though Platform 1 requires careful navigation via a barrow crossing. While there are no waiting rooms, the station does provide sheltered seating areas for your comfort.
CCTV ensures added security, and customer help points offer passenger support between 08:00 and 20:00 on weekdays and 10:00 to 20:00 on Sundays. Despite the absence of a dedicated ticket office, the induction loop and accessible ticket machines provide necessary assistance to the hard-of-hearing and those with mobility concerns.
Thurston offers seamless transport connections, ensuring you’re never stranded. For those occasions when train services might be disrupted, a convenient rail replacement bus service operates, picking up and dropping off at Station Hill, near the station car park. While taxi services and cycle hire options aren’t available directly at the station, local bus services serve as a reliable alternative for onward connections.
